Who is Denver Arts Venues
Denver Arts & Venues is a government agency based in Denver, Colorado, with 49 employees and an annual revenue of $4.2 million. The agency is dedicated to enhancing the quality of life and economic prosperity of Denver through the promotion of arts, culture, and entertainment opportunities for all residents. Denver Arts & Venues manages several prominent venues in the region, including Red Rocks Amphitheatre, Denver Performing Arts Complex, Colorado Convention Center, Denver Coliseum, Loretto Heights, and McNichols Civic Center Building. The agency also oversees the Denver Public Art Program, which includes funding initiatives such as the Urban Arts Fund, P.S. You Are Here, and Denver Music Advancement Fund. Additionally, Denver Arts & Venues implements Denver's Cultural Plan and organizes cultural events like the Five Points Jazz Festival. Funds generated by the agency are reinvested back into the community through grants awarded to artists and arts organizations, the provision of free and low-cost cultural events, public art installations, venue upkeep and maintenance, and arts education programs.
